So, how does AI-powered text-to-video technology work?
The process begins with the input of text-based content, such as medical research findings, clinical guidelines, or training materials, into the AI-powered software. The AI algorithm then analyzes the text, identifies key concepts, and generates corresponding visuals, animations, and voiceovers. This seamless integration of AI and creative tools like Canva allows for the creation of engaging and interactive learning and training videos.

While AI-powered text-to-video technology holds immense potential, it is essential to acknowledge its limitations. AI algorithms are not immune to biases, and there is a need for ongoing monitoring and refinement to ensure accuracy and fairness. Additionally, the human touch should not be completely eliminated. Healthcare professionals still require the guidance and expertise of experienced trainers and educators to supplement the learning experience.
